Hunting in Veneto. The regional council has approved in recent days the councilor's proposal for Hunting, Giuseppe Pan, concerning the inclusion of changes to the contents of the Regional hunting calendar 2015-2016 as far as hunting the Pochard species is concerned.
The changes made concern the game bags, fixing following the evaluations of Birdlife International according to which this species was vulnerable therefore instead of the maximum of five daily animals and fifty seasonal animals, the approved changes show the game bag for the hunting the Pochard to 15 daily items and 150 seasonal items.
Another subject of the changes concerns the much-contested two additional days for hunting for stalking migratory in the months of October and November which now also apply to the lagoon-valley territory limited to the part of it subject to scheduled hunting management.

SUBJECT: Amendment to DGR n.868 of 13.07.2015 “Hunting season 2015/2016. Approval of the regional hunting calendar (LRn50 / 1993 art.16) ".
NOTE FOR TRANSPARENCY:
The provision modifies the current regional hunting calendar approved with DGR n. 868 of 13.07.2015 with regard to the authorized game bags for the Pochard species (Aythya ferina). The provision also provides clarifications regarding the provisions of point 6 of the same regional hunting calendar with regard to the application, in the months of October and November, of the two supplementary days to the emigration from stalking.
Councilor Giuseppe Pan reports the following.
With DGR n. 868 of 13.07.2015, the regional council approved the hunting calendar for the 2015/2016 season. When setting the game boxes referred to the Pochard species (Aythya ferina), this provision introduced limitations to the daily (five head) and seasonal (fifty head) game bag taking into account the assessment made by Birdlifeinternational (European Red List of Birds of Birdlifeinternational 2015) which attributes the status of currently vulnerable species to the Pochard.
